Abstract
Rolling tractor tube mechanical thrombectomy apparatuses that may be deployed from out of a catheter in situ are described herein. These apparatuses may be delivered out of a catheter from a collapsed delivery configuration within the catheter to a deployed configuration out of the catheter, in which the same catheter is re-inserted between a tubular tractor and an elongate puller. In particular, any of these methods and apparatuses may be adapted to work with a tractor tube having an open end that is biased open, including using an annular bias.

20. A method of deploying a mechanical thrombectomy apparatus for removing a clot from a vessel, the method comprising:
-
positioning an elongate inversion support catheter within a lumen of the vessel; extending an elongate puller and a flexible tractor tube out of a distal end of the elongate inversion support catheter, wherein the flexible tractor tube has a free first end coupled to an annular bias and a second end that is coupled to a distal end region of the elongate puller, so that the flexible tractor tube expands from a collapsed first configuration within the elongate inversion support catheter into an expanded second configuration, and wherein the annular bias holds the flexible tractor tube open to a diameter that is larger than an outer diameter of the elongate inversion support catheter when the flexible tractor tube is in the expanded second configuration; advancing the elongate inversion support catheter distally through the annular bias and between the flexible tractor tube and the elongate puller; and pulling the elongate puller proximally to roll the flexible tractor tube over a distal end opening of the elongate inversion support catheter so that the flexible tractor tube inverts into the elongate inversion support catheter, wherein the flexible tractor tube is biased in an un-inverted configuration to expand to between 1.1 and 4 times an outer diameter of the elongate inversion support catheter and is further biased in an inverted configuration to expand to greater than 0.5×
an inner diameter of the elongate inversion support catheter within the elongate inversion support catheter. - View Dependent Claims (21, 22, 23, 24, 25, 26)
